The decision to make one of the game’s main characters a woman is also being touted as a sign that the studio has improved. Sources within Rockstar Games said that the character will be one of two playable leads who form the center of aThe female protagonist, a Latina, will apparently be treated respectfully by the studio that has vowed not to punch down anymore with jokes about marginalized groups, in contrast to previous games in the series.
Similarly, Rockstar is trying to address its games’ treatment of minority groups. The upcoming game reportedly once featured a “Cops ‘n’ Crooks” game mode that saw teams of police and criminals play against one another.
